What body does Reader end up in?
An imperial prince assassinated in a power struggle.
Reader woke up in the body of Prince Reynault Armata. As the memories of the prince started merging with his, Reader brought his hand to his neck to find it still wet with warm blood. However the gash which he had died from had fully mended.
Now as prince Reynault, Reader picked himself up from the ground where he had bled out and took stock of his surroundings. He was standing in the midst of what was left of his ambushed imperial convoy. The bodies of his knights, servants, carriages and horses were strewn about carelessly along the stretch of lonely forest road, while the full moon overhead gleefully bathed them in her haunting pale light.
In hindsight, Reynault wasn’t at all surprised that an attempt had been made on his life. He was just amazed at the audacity and openness with which the attack had taken place. To ambush a member of royalty and his imperial convoy this close to the imperial city itself? One would have to be pretty bold, or pretty stupid, or perhaps pretty **** to pull off such a sacrilege. Probably all three.
This all started three months ago during the winter. The old emperor, Solomon Arxlanta, had finally succumbed to the illness and poor health that had been plaguing him for the better part of 2 years, leaving behind seven ‘grieving’ queens, and at least twice the number of eligible heirs, both male and female.
Perhaps out of sloth, or spite, or perhaps all part of his plan, the late emperor failed to determine an order of succession among his many heirs. Conversely, he had been known to be unpredictable in his favor, showering one heir with attention while keeping the others at arm’s length, and then making another his favorite out of the blue while snubbing the others.
As things stand, the Empire of Arx lies divided into seven factions, each supporting one of the seven houses of the widowed queens and the claim of their children to the throne.
“This could prove interesting,” Reynault muttered to himself.
Yet a part of him, perhaps a remnant of the departed prince’s desire, wished to leave behind the imperial burden, politics, and intrigue. Tired of it all, he just wanted to disappear from his current life and start another. Thanks to the ambush, it would seem like there was no better time to slip away than this very moment.
“It would seem that I am at a crossroad,” Reynault said. “I could…”
- Give a flying fuck about my right to succession, take this opportunity to escape and start a new life under a new identity.
- Continue on to the imperial city, reinstate myself in this treacherous game of imperial succession and aim for the crown.
